You are not at the screen at 11.04. The position is a small midcap, bought two days ago at ₹296, with a stop-loss order resting at ₹291 — comfortably below a fortnight of lows, chosen deliberately so that ordinary noise would not reach it. The phone buzzes at 11.06 with a fill: sold, 640 shares, ₹271. You open the chart and the morning looks exactly as you left it, a quiet range between ₹297 and ₹303, except for one candle with a spike of a wick hanging off the bottom of it, down to ₹268, on a body that begins and ends around ₹299. The stock is at ₹300 while you are looking at it. Nothing was announced. Nobody sold anything. For about four seconds, one order took the price down twenty-nine rupees, and in those four seconds it collected your stop on the way past.
This is a freak trade, and the first thing to understand about it is that it is not an error in the ordinary sense. No system malfunctioned. The exchange matched an order against the orders that were sitting there to be matched against, in the order the rules require, and the trades that resulted are real trades: they settled, somebody paid for them, and they are in the exchange’s own record of the day. The chart is not lying to you. The chart is telling you the truth about something that should not have happened.
A surveyor measures the same field eleven times and writes down eleven numbers. Ten of them are between 40 and 41 metres. The eleventh says 4 metres, because that time the tape caught on a stone and folded. He does not throw away the notebook, and he does not average all eleven either. He knows which reading is the fold, and he knows the difference between a reading that is unusual and a reading that is not a reading at all.
Your data has folds in it. They are rare, they are not distributed like ordinary volatility, and every indicator you own averages them in without asking. The skill is not in never having them. It is in knowing which of your numbers eat them and which do not.
How one order gets to a price nobody was offering
A [[Market order]] does not have a price. It is an instruction to trade the quantity at whatever prices are available, and it is matched against the resting limit orders in the [[Order book]], best price first, until the quantity is exhausted. In a liquid name the book is thick — there are thousands of shares bid within a few paise of each other — so a market order for 5,000 shares clears against the top few rungs and moves the price a little. In a thin name the book is a ladder with most of the rungs missing. A market sell order for 5,000 shares meets 300 at ₹297, then 200 at ₹294, then nothing at all until somebody’s speculative bid at ₹268 that has been sitting there for a week hoping for exactly this. The order walks all the way down and prints every rung it touches.
- The size was a mistake, or the account was. A quantity typed with an extra zero, an algorithm with a bad parameter, or a client whose position was being liquidated by a risk system that was told to sell now rather than sell well.
- The book was empty for a legitimate reason. Market makers pull quotes around scheduled events, and in an illiquid name there was never much of a book to pull. The same order that would be absorbed at 2.30 in the afternoon walks the ladder at 9.20 in the morning.
- Somebody wanted the print. A price touched briefly at a chosen moment can trigger a settlement value, a stop cluster, or a level a lot of people are watching. This is a market-abuse question rather than a charting one, and it is not for you to adjudicate — but the resulting bar behaves identically to the accidental kind, which is the only part that concerns your indicators.
What stops it, and why what stops it is not enough
Exchanges do not let an order walk indefinitely. Most securities carry a daily price band — a fixed percentage away from the previous close, beyond which orders are simply not accepted — and securities that do not carry a fixed daily band instead sit inside a [[Dynamic price band]], a narrower operating range around a reference price that the exchange can widen in steps once it sees genuine two-sided interest at the edge. Brokers layer their own, tighter, order-value and price-range checks on top. Between them, these controls put a floor under how far a single order can travel.
Nor should you count on the trade being undone. Exchanges do have a route by which a trade can be annulled, but it is exceptional, it has to be applied for within a tight window, and the presumption throughout is against interfering with a concluded trade — because somebody on the other side of it has a perfectly good bargain that they are entitled to keep. Plan on the working assumption that the trade stands, the fill is yours, and the print is in the historical series permanently.
Which of your numbers eat the wick, and which do not
This is the practical half of the lesson, and it is much simpler than it sounds. Every indicator you use takes some subset of the four numbers in a bar. If it only ever reads the close, a wick cannot touch it. If it reads the high or the low, the wick goes straight in.
| What the indicator reads | Examples | Effect of a four-second wick |
|---|---|---|
| Close only | Moving averages of close, RSI, MACD, rate of change, Bollinger Bands | None. The close was ₹299 and the calculation never sees ₹268. This is why a freak trade can be invisible on one chart and dominate the one next to it |
| High and low | Average true range and everything built on it — ADX, Keltner channels, Parabolic SAR; plus stochastic, Williams %R, Donchian channels, Aroon | Direct and large. The bar’s range is now the wick, and a range that was ₹5 is ₹35 |
| High, low and close together | Pivot points, CCI and anything using a typical price of (high + low + close) ÷ 3 | Every level derived from the session is shifted downward by roughly a third of the wick |
| Weighted by volume | VWAP and anchored VWAP | Usually small, because the freak trades were a handful of shares against a day’s turnover — but only if your platform weights each trade. A platform that approximates VWAP as bar typical price times bar volume gives the wick the whole bar’s volume, and then it is not small at all |
| Order-triggering, not indicator | Stop-loss orders resting at the exchange | A stop is released into the book when the last traded price reaches its trigger. Four seconds is plenty. And once released as a market order it fills against the same emptied book that caused the problem |
Telling a fold from a real reading
You cannot act on any of this until you can distinguish a freak trade from a genuine violent move, and there is no single test that settles it. There are four, and they agree with each other far more often than not.
- 1Look at the volume in the offending minute
A genuine collapse is thousands of trades and a large share of the day’s turnover. A freak trade is a handful of trades and a quantity that looks trivial next to the daily figure. If the extreme price carries almost no volume, it was a ladder being walked rather than a market changing its mind.
- 2Look at how long the price stayed there
Drop to a one-minute chart. Real repricing takes minutes and leaves a cluster of bars near the new level, usually with elevated volume on both sides of it. A fold is one bar with a wick and neighbours that never went near it.
- 3Check the other exchange
For a stock listed on both venues, a genuine move appears on both within the same minute, because the arbitrage between them is fast and heavily contested. A print on one venue with nothing at all on the other is a book being walked on that venue.
- 4Check the exchange’s own end-of-day file
The [[Bhavcopy]] carries the session’s high and low as the exchange recorded them. If your platform shows a low the exchange’s file does not, the fault is in your feed and is a different problem from a freak trade. If the file carries it too, the print is real, it is permanent, and the rest of this module is about what you do next.

- A freak trade is a real, settled trade — a market order walking a thin order book, not a system fault.
- Price bands and dynamic bands bound how far it can walk; they do not stop the print appearing.
- Indicators that read only the close are untouched; anything reading the high or low takes the full wick.
- A single wick lifts Wilder’s ATR sharply and leaves about a third of the distortion in place a fortnight later.
- Volume in the minute, how long price stayed, the other exchange and the exchange’s own file will usually settle whether it was real.
